About Us

MyLeave (Construction Industry Long Service Leave Payments Board) is a Western Australian statutory authority responsible for providing financially sustainable portable long service leave for around 131,000 construction workers.

MyLeave is currently undertaking an ambitious digital transformation program, with a key outcome being the replacement of legacy core CRM and records management systems and digitisation of manual processes. It is expected that the new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M and Microsoft SharePoint platforms will be commissioned in 2024. An additional focus is to maintain and improve our cyber security mitigation and prevention strategies.
